The From: address is not necessarily accurate - now if everyone used
GnuPG signatures and the mailserver could be configured to only allow
sigs in the DCGLUG keyring . . . .

IMHO, there is every chance that gmail is being targetted by spammers
as a "friendly" From alias just like hotmail and msn before it.
